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 003 Hazard:
29 CFR 1915.1001(f)(2)(i): The employer did not ensure that a "qualified person" conducted an exposure assessment immediately before or at the initiation of operations to ascertain expected exposures in the workplace or during the operation: a) On or about August 27, 2016, in the area damaged during a collision at level A of the floating dry-dock, employees were instructed to conduct Class III asbestos work and the employer failed to ensure that an initial exposure assessment was conducted by a qualified person before employees started to remove a section of duct work covered with thermal system insulation (TSI) known to contain asbestos, exposing employees working to asbestos airborne concentrations that may have exceeded the permissible exposure limit (PEL).
